The Torrington Titans (20-26) built an early lead against the Pittsfield Suns (23-24), scoring five runs in the first inning, en route to a 7-2 win on Sunday at Fuessenich Park.
Casey Jones was hot from the plate for the Torrington Titans. Jones went 2-4, drove in one and scored two runs. He singled in the fourth and sixth innings.
Pat Austin recorded his fourth win of the year for the Torrington Titans. He allowed two runs over 5 2/3 innings. He struck out three, walked none and surrendered six hits.
Josh Martin couldn't get it done on the mound for the Pittsfield Suns, taking a loss. He allowed seven runs in six innings, walked four and struck out three.
